For the 2025-26 school year, there are 3 public middle schools serving 2,093 students in Wildwood, MO. The top ranked public middle schools in Wildwood, MO are Rockwood Valley Middle School, Wildwood Middle School and Lasalle Springs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Wildwood, MO public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 59% (versus the Missouri public middle school average of 39%), and reading proficiency score of 59% (versus the 40% statewide average). Middle schools in Wildwood have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 5% of Missouri public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Asian and Black), which is less than the Missouri public middle school average of 31% (majority Black).
